Beyond the Visible - Introduction to Hyperspectral Remote Sensing

Hyperspectral Remote Sensing Course

GFZ Potsdam

EO College

https://eo-college.org/courses/beyond-the-visible/

Text adapted from https://eo-college.org

‘Beyond the Visible – Introduction to Hyperspectral Remote Sensing‘.

In this course, you will learn the basics of imaging spectroscopy. No matter if you are a student or a professional or whatever continent you are from, this course was designed for you and we hope to provide some helpful background information, process understanding and applications that relate to your area of interest or expertise.

What will you learn?

This course will provide you, not only with the fundamentals of imaging spectroscopy, but also gives you access to free data sources, open-source software and hands-on training exercises.

By the end of this course, you should have learned …

  • what imaging spectroscopy is
  • what application fields it is useful for
  • what the physical background is
  • which sensors are commonly used
  • how spectroscopy data are acquired
  • where you can get data from
  • what software you could use
  • and finally first processing steps to analyze them

The rising number of imaging spectrometers deployed on airborne platforms and the launch of space-borne imaging spectroscopy missions are accompanied by an increasing need for education and training activities with a focus on hyperspectral imagery – with the data becoming more and more available, you need to know how to best use it and benefit from its great potential. Learn from a variety of experts and adopt the knowledge to your personal research interest(s).
